What affects the price

Plumbing costs change based on the complexity of the repair and the accessibility of the pipes. If a pro needs to cut into drywall or dig underground to reach a leak, the labor time increases. Older homes sometimes require updating outdated materials, like galvanized steel, to meet current codes. The timing of the service also matters, as after-hours or holiday calls often carry different rates than standard business hours. While simple drain clearings or fixture swaps are usually on the lower end, larger system repipes cost more.

What is involved in a plumbing drain clog service?

A plumbing drain clog service in Cleveland involves identifying the blockage and clearing it. Professionals use tools like drain snakes or hydro-jetting to remove obstructions effectively. They can also determine the cause of the clog, whether it's grease, hair, or foreign objects. Proper clearing ensures the drain flows freely and prevents recurring issues. This service is crucial for maintaining household hygiene and preventing water backups.

When should I consider a plumber for a toilet leak in Cleveland?

You should call a plumber for a toilet leak in Cleveland as soon as you notice any water seeping. Leaks can occur from the tank, the fill valve, the flapper, or the seal at the base. A persistent leak wastes water and can lead to water damage on your bathroom floor. Addressing it quickly is more cost-effective than dealing with potential mold or structural issues. Professional assessment ensures a complete repair.

How do I prepare for a plumber to install a toilet?

To prepare for a plumber installing a toilet, ensure the area around it is clear of obstructions. Remove any decorative items or cleaning supplies. Shutting off the water supply valve behind the toilet can expedite the process. Having the new toilet and any required supplies readily accessible is also helpful. This allows the professional to work efficiently and complete the installation smoothly.

What is the difference between a plumber and a plumbing contractor?

In Cleveland, a plumber is a skilled tradesperson who performs installations and repairs. A plumbing contractor typically manages larger projects, supervises teams of plumbers, and handles client communication. Contractors often deal with new construction, major renovations, and complex system installations. Both are licensed professionals, but contractors have broader project management responsibilities.
